What is a Bidirectional Inverter?

A bidirectional inverter is a device that can convert power in two directions:

  1. AC to DC: Converts AC power (e.g., from the grid or a generator) into DC power to charge batteries.

  2. DC to AC: Converts DC power (e.g., from batteries or solar panels) into AC power to run household appliances and devices.
